Transaction 1c86badcc8a1a560007b73e8e81faaf619607af465f0e73f687894abc663bd4f

27 Input
2 Outputs
  • 1c86badcc8a1a560007b73e8e81faaf619607af465f0e73f687894abc663bd4f:0
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 1c86badcc8a1a560007b73e8e81faaf619607af465f0e73f687894abc663bd4f:1
  • value  592652
    address  1FDnKmvbhwM7zW2d1poQbWdzaDZo5PoBnT